gpt4 book ai didi

javascript - 生成一个按钮并将其绑定(bind)到另一个 onclick 函数

转载 作者:行者123 更新时间:2023-12-03 01:47:23 32 4
gpt4 key购买 nike

如何添加按钮并对外部 onclick 函数使用react?我也需要它可用于生成的按钮和网站上的静态按钮。目前,我有两次该功能,使其适用于两种按钮,但这似乎有点多余。

button.on("click", function() {
banner.addClass("alt")
$("<br><button class='test'>TEST</button><br>").insertAfter(button);

//Here it works for the generated button:
$(".test").on("click", function() {
banner.removeClass("alt")
banner.addClass("alt2")
})

})

//Here it only works with the static buttons:
$(".test").on("click", function() {
banner.removeClass("alt")
banner.addClass("alt2")
})

https://jsfiddle.net/tdL3s4f8/

最佳答案

通过以下方式将单击监听器添加到父容器元素句柄。我选择文档作为父级,您可以更具体。

$(document).on('click', '.test', function(){
banner.removeClass("alt")
banner.addClass("alt2")
})

关于javascript - 生成一个按钮并将其绑定(bind)到另一个 onclick 函数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50576877/

32 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com